SF says more public trash cans wouldn’t solve its trash problem. Why?


Listen Later

San Francisco is a trashy city. We're not talking about the vibes – we’re talking about the state of our sidewalks.


Anyone who lives here knows the feeling of walking down the street with something to throw away… and absolutely nowhere to put it.


Because SF has shockingly few public trash cans. How has one of the wealthiest cities in the world ended up so short on such a basic need? And what would it take to fix SF’s dirtiest problem? Turns out, there’s a lot more to the story behind SF’s trash problems than you might think.
